Strong’s Definitions

Σήθ Sḗth, sayth; of Hebrew origin (H8352); Seth (i.e. Sheth), a patriarch:—Seth.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 1x

The KJV translates Strong's G4589 in the following manner: Seth (1x).

  1. Seth = "compensation"

    1. the third son of Adam and the father of Enos

STRONGS G4589:
Σήθ, (שֵׁת, 'put' (A. V. 'appointed'), from שׁוּת, to put (i. e. in place of the murdered Abel; cf. B. D. under the word ), Genesis 4:25), Seth, the third sou of Adam: Luke 3:38.
